The Australian Street Rod Federation (ASRF) is the national controlling body for the sport / hobby of rodding in Australia.

The primary function of this website is to provide general information to rodders about the ASRF and rodding in Australia. Aussie rodders with technical questions should contact their State TAC representative to obtain the most up to date and relevant information.

CONSTRUCTION
These web pages are created and maintained using DiDa Pro and Netscape Navigator Gold 3, on a Hewlett Packard Vectra VL 5/133 running Windows95. Images were created from photographs scanned using a UMax Astra 1200s flatbed scanner. Images are optimised for the web using Ulead Photoimpact 3.01. There were several design considerations that were taken into account when constructing the site. Most important were speed of display and the being able to be viewed by a majority of the different versions of browsers. Therefore at this stage the site does not use forms, tables, frames or image maps.
